What is Microdermabrasion?

Microdermabrasion is a non-invasive skincare treatment that involves using a device to exfoliate the outer layer of the skin. This helps to remove dead skin cells, unclog pores, and stimulate collagen production. Microdermabrasion can be done on the face, neck, chest, hands, and other parts of the body.

Factors That Affect How Often You Should Get Microdermabrasion Treatments

There are several factors that can affect how often you should get microdermabrasion treatments. These include:

Skin Type

People with oily or acne-prone skin may benefit from more frequent microdermabrasion treatments, while those with sensitive skin may need to space out their treatments more.

Skin Concerns

If you have specific skin concerns, such as acne scars or hyperpigmentation, you may need more frequent treatments to see the best results.

Age

As we age, our skin’s natural exfoliation process slows down, which can lead to dull, uneven skin. Older adults may benefit from more frequent microdermabrasion treatments to help maintain healthy, glowing skin.

How Often Should You Get Microdermabrasion Treatments?

So, how often should you get microdermabrasion treatments? The answer depends on a variety of factors, but in general, it’s recommended to get microdermabrasion treatments every 4-6 weeks.

This time frame allows your skin to fully heal between treatments and ensures that you’re not over-exfoliating, which can lead to irritation and sensitivity. Additionally, getting microdermabrasion treatments on a regular basis can help to maintain the results of previous treatments and improve overall skin health.

How to Maximize the Results of Microdermabrasion Treatments

To get the most out of your microdermabrasion treatments, it’s important to take care of your skin in between sessions. Here are some tips to help you maximize the results of your treatments:

Stay Hydrated

Drinking plenty of water can help to keep your skin hydrated and healthy, which can improve the results of your microdermabrasion treatments.

Use Sunscreen

After your microdermabrasion treatment, your skin may be more sensitive to the sun. To protect your skin, be sure to use sunscreen with at least SPF 30 every day.

Avoid Harsh Products

In the days following your microdermabrasion treatment, avoid using harsh skincare products that can irritate your skin. Stick to gentle, non-irritating products to help your skin heal.

FAQs

Is microdermabrasion painful?

Microdermabrasion is generally not a painful procedure. However, some people may experience mild discomfort or a slight tingling sensation during the treatment. Your skin may also feel slightly sensitive or tender immediately after the treatment.

How long does a microdermabrasion treatment take?

A typical microdermabrasion treatment takes around 30-60 minutes, depending on the area being treated. However, the exact length of the treatment may vary depending on your specific needs and the techniques used by your skincare professional.

Can I wear makeup after a microdermabrasion treatment?

It’s generally recommended to avoid wearing makeup immediately after a microdermabrasion treatment. This allows your skin to fully heal and recover from the treatment. Most skincare professionals recommend waiting at least 24 hours before applying makeup to the treated area.

How soon can I see results from microdermabrasion?

You may notice some immediate improvements in your skin after a microdermabrasion treatment, such as increased smoothness and brightness. However, it typically takes a few sessions to see more significant improvements in skin texture, fine lines, and hyperpigmentation.

Can microdermabrasion be done at home?

While there are at-home microdermabrasion kits available, it’s generally recommended to get microdermabrasion treatments done by a trained skincare professional. This ensures that the treatment is done safely and effectively and can help you achieve the best results possible.
